๐ Congratulations to Alicia Hirnikel, kindergarten teacher, on being named Mason Schools Foundation's 2026 Teacher of the Year at Mason Early Childhood Center! ๐
For the past 10 years, Alicia has welcomed Mason's youngest learners into kindergarten with patience, enthusiasm, and a commitment to helping every child feel seen, valued, and capable of success. Inspired by the amazing educators she had growing up, Alicia pursued a degree in Early Childhood Education at Miami University. She was fortunate to complete her student teaching at MECC, where she quickly felt at home and later began her teaching career after graduation. Alicia has since earned her Master's degree in Special Education and has spent her entire 10 year teaching career serving Mason families.
Outside the classroom, Alicia enjoys walking, hiking, and spending time on her family's boat. Her passion for working with children extends beyond school as well. She volunteers with a high school youth group that meets weekly for service projects and activities throughout the year and spends a week each summer volunteering at a camp for children with Muscular Dystrophy.
Alicia creates a classroom where learning is exciting, inclusion is celebrated, and every student has the opportunity to shine. Whether she's dressing up as a superhero to celebrate reading milestones, ensuring no child is left out of a classroom activity, or helping students discover their unique strengths, Alicia truly goes โAbove & Beyondโ to make kindergarten a joyful and meaningful experience.
Parents describe her as an exceptional communicator, an organized and trusted partner, and a teacher whose care extends far beyond the classroom. Former students love seeing Ms. Hirnikel around the building and often stop to say hello, share big news of losing a tooth, and receive a warm hug. This is a testament to the lasting impact she has on the children and families she serves.
One of Alicia's favorite moments this year came when a student surprised classmates by using his communication device to speak in full sentences and identify letter sounds. The excitement and pride shared by the entire class perfectly reflect the inclusive, supportive environment she works so hard to create every day.
"I am incredibly honored and grateful to receive this recognition," Alicia shared. "Teaching is something I truly love, and it means so much to be supported by such an amazing school community."
